Summary
An issue was discovered in the A4N (Aremis 4 Nomad) application 1.5.0 for Android. It possesses an authentication mechanism; however, some features do not require any token or cookie in a request. Therefore, an attacker may send a simple HTTP request to the right endpoint, and obtain authorization to retrieve application data.
